About The Position

The Vendor Specialist is overall responsible for managing the relationship with our CPO Vendors. They will ensure that third-party vendors deliver consistent, high-quality, and cost-effective products and services aligned with organizational goals. This position is responsible for establishing and maintaining strong vendor relationships, driving performance through defined metrics and governance, and ensuring compliance with contractual, operational, and risk requirements.

Responsibilities

  • Serve as the primary relationship owner for assigned vendors, acting as the main operational and strategic point of contact
  • Monitor vendor performance against defined SLAs, KPIs, and quality standards
  • Conduct regular business reviews with vendors, providing feedback and driving continuous improvement initiatives
  • Identify performance gaps and implement corrective action plans
  • Establish and maintain vendor governance frameworks, including reporting, review cadences, and escalation protocols
  • Lead issue resolution and escalation management with vendors and internal stakeholders
  • Ensure adherence to contractual obligations and policies
  • Maintain proper documentation of vendor processes, controls, and performance
  • Monitor vendor spend, identify cost optimization opportunities, and support budgeting/forecasting activities
  • Assist in contract negotiations, renewals, and pricing discussions
  • Track ROI and value delivered from vendor relationships
  • Partner with internal business units to align vendor services with operational needs
  • Provide insights and reporting to leadership on vendor performance and trends
  • Support cross-functional initiatives involving multiple vendors and stakeholders
  • Drive process improvements and standardization across vendor management practices
  • Leverage analytics and reporting to identify trends and opportunities
  • Participate in vendor selection and onboarding activities
